Kitora
Kitora is a village located in Gairatganj tehsil of Raisen district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 15km away from sub-district headquarter Gairatgang (tehsildar office) and 70km away from district headquarter Raisen. As per 2009 stats, Sarra is the gram panchayat of Kitora village.

About Kitora
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kitora is 483977. The village spans a total geographical area of 259.46 hectares. Gairatganj is nearest town to Kitora village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 15km away.

Population of Kitora
According to the 2011 Census, Kitora has a total population of about 435, with approximately 209 males and 226 females. The sex ratio is around 1081 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 77 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 65 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 77. The overall literacy rate is approximately 70.80%, with male literacy at about 77.03% and female literacy near 65.04%. There are around 91 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Kitora's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 435 | 209 | 226 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 77 | 30 | 47 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 65 | 33 | 32 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 77 | 38 | 39 |
Literate Population | 308 | 161 | 147 |
Illiterate Population | 127 | 48 | 79 |
Connectivity of Kitora
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kitora. As per the 2011 stats, Kitora had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
